What Is Jizz Lube?
Jizz lube is a type of sexual lubricant uniquely engineered to closely mimic the look, feel, and sometimes the scent of real semen. Its thick white, creamy texture provides a visually and tactilely realistic addition to intimate activities, making it especially popular for erotic roleplay, porn recreations, bukkake fantasies, squirting dildo use, and photo or film shoots that want the “money shot” aesthetic.

How to Choose the Right Jizz Lube
Key Considerations
- Base Formula (Water or Hybrid)
- Water-based lubes are generally the most versatile, compatible with all toy materials, non-staining, and easy to wash away.
-
Hybrid lubes combine water-based and silicone ingredients to provide longer-lasting glide and more realistic consistency, but may be harder to remove completely from some fabrics.
-
Realism: Appearance, Texture, and Scent
- If visual realism is critical, choose a lube that offers a creamy, milky-white look.
-
For roleplay, a subtle musky scent may enhance the authenticity, but if you are scent-sensitive, opt for unscented versions.
-
Ingredient Safety
- Check for glycerin, parabens, and preservatives. If you have sensitivities or want to minimize irritation risk, pick a paraben-free and glycerin-free option.
-
Edible/Oral-safe jizz lubes are rare; most are for external use only. Do not ingest unless the product is clearly labeled safe for consumption.
-
Specific Use (Solo, Partnered, Toy-Use, Photo/Film)
- For squirting toys, pick a lube that works well in the toy’s reservoir and doesn’t clog.
-
For photo/video, a thicker, frothy lube tends to look more authentic under lights.
-
Cleaning and Staining
-
Most commercial jizz lubes are non-staining and clean up easily, but always read reviews for reports of residue or staining—especially on bedding.
-
Allergy and Sensitivity Concerns
-
Scan the ingredient list for known allergens, and do a patch test if you’re trying a new product.
-
Price vs. Volume
- Most jizz lubes are pricier than standard lubricants due to specialty ingredients and appearance. Compare cost per ounce for large play sessions or if using with toys that require more product.
User Tips & Best Practices for Jizz Lube
- Warm It Up: To boost realism, submerge the bottle (closed) in warm water for a few minutes before use. Warm jizz lube mimics body temperature, enhancing the authenticity.
- Mess Management: Have towels, body-safe wipes, or a shower nearby. Jizz lube is designed to be messy, which can be part of the fun, but preparation makes post-play cleanup easier.
- Patch Test: Try a small amount on your inner arm before full use to check for any skin reactions, especially if you have sensitivities to fragrances or preservatives.
- Toy & Condom Safety: Most jizz lubes are compatible with all condoms and sex toys, but always double-check the packaging. Avoid oil-based lubes if using latex.
- Application: For squirting dildos or ejaculating toys, pour the lube into the reservoir and test the consistency to ensure unsullied performance.
- Oral Play: Only use lubes labeled as “edible” or “food-grade” if you intend to have oral contact.
- Storage: Keep lid tightly sealed and store in a cool, dry place. Water-based formulas can dry out or thicken if exposed to air for long periods.

FAQ
-
What is jizz lube and how does it differ from regular lubricants?
Jizz lube is specialty lube formulated to mimic the texture, color, and sometimes scent of real semen. Unlike clear or colored lubes, its creamy white appearance adds realism for certain fantasies and roleplay, but it can be used in place of any normal water-based or hybrid lube. -
Is jizz lube safe for use with all sex toys and condoms?
Most jizz lubes are water-based or hybrid, making them compatible with latex condoms and common sex toy materials like silicone, glass, metal, and rubber. Always check your product’s label for compatibility to avoid material degradation. -
Can jizz lube be used for anal or vaginal sex?
Yes, most jizz lubes are designed for both vaginal and anal play. Always read the manufacturer’s directions first; some may be formulated for external use only, or may cause irritation if you have sensitive skin. -
Is jizz lube edible or safe for oral sex?
Most jizz lubes are not intended to be swallowed. Only use a product marked as “edible” or “food-grade” for oral sex. If not marked so, avoid ingestion. -
Does jizz lube stain sheets or clothing?
Most commercial jizz lubes are formulated to be non-staining and easy to wash, but heavily pigmented or very thick options might leave some residue. Always spot test before using on expensive fabrics. -
How do I clean up after using jizz lube?
Water-based jizz lube wipes away easily with soapy water or a wet cloth. For hybrid (water/silicone) products, a thorough wash with soap and water is usually sufficient. -
Will scented jizz lube cause irritation?
If you have fragrance sensitivities, opt for unscented versions to reduce the risk of irritation. Always patch test any new lube on a small area of skin before full use. -
Can I use jizz lube with ejaculating dildos or toys?
Yes, jizz lube is ideal for squirting or ejaculating toys. Choose a formula that matches the reservoir specifications and maintains viscosity for realistic effect without clogging. -
How long does jizz lube last once opened?
When stored in a cool, dry place with the cap tightly sealed, most jizz lubes have a shelf life of 1–2 years. If the scent, texture, or appearance changes, discard and replace. -
What should I do if I experience irritation or discomfort?
Immediately cease use and wash the area with gentle soap and water. If irritation persists, contact your healthcare provider. Review ingredient lists and switch to a hypoallergenic, paraben- and glycerin-free lubrication option if you have a history of sensitivity.
